BROKE框架

概念

Background 背景:提供足够的背景信息,使GPT能够理解问题的上下文。

Role 角色:设定特定的角色,让GPT能够根据该角色来生成响应。

Objectives 目标:明确任务目标,让GPT清楚知道需要实现什么。

Key Result 关键结果:定义关键的、可衡量的结果,以便让GPT知道如何衡量目标的完成情况。

Evolve 演变 :通过试验和调整来测试结果,并根据需要进行优化。

示例

如何提高编程技能。

Background 背景:编程是一种重要的技能,能帮助解决各种问题。随着技术的快速发展,不断地学习和提高编程技能变得至关重要。

Role 角色:假设你是一名经验丰富的编程导师,能提供实用的建议和指导。

Objectives 目标:

  1. 了解编程基础和核心概念。
  2. 通过实际项目实践和提高编程技能。
  3. 接受同行和导师的反馈,了解进步和需要改进的地方。

Key Result 关键结果:

  1. 完成至少5个不同类型的编程项目。
  2. 每个项目后都能获得专业的反馈和建议。
  3. 至少阅读和总结10篇关于编程最佳实践和新技术的文章。

Evolve 演变:

  1. 每个月评估一次学习进度,调整学习计划。
  2. 根据项目实践和反馈来调整学习资源和方法。
  3. 如果发现某个学习资源或方法不再有效,寻找新的替代方案。

提示词

编程是一种重要的技能,能帮助我们解决各种问题。随着技术的快速发展,不断地学习和提高编程技能变得至关重要。假设你是一名经验丰富的编程导师,能提供实用的建议和指导。我希望你能帮助我达成三个目标:第一,了解编程基础和核心概念;第二,通过实际项目实践和提高编程技能;第三,接受同行和导师的反馈,了解进步和需要改进的地方。同时,帮助我完成三个结果:第一,完成至少5个不同类型的编程项目;第二,每个项目后都能获得专业的反馈和建议;第三,至少阅读和总结10篇关于编程最佳实践和新技术的文章。并且,能够帮助我持续提升:第一,每个月评估一次学习进度,调整学习计划;第二,根据项目实践和反馈来调整学习资源和方法;第三,如果发现某个学习资源或方法不再有效,寻找新的替代方案。